Question
In this account, the account holder is required to deposit a specific amount every month. After the expiry of the specified period, the depositor gets back his money together with interest thereon.
Options
Current account
Recurring deposit account
Saving account
None of these

Solution
Recurring deposit account
Explanation:
A Recurring Deposit (RD) account is a type of term deposit that allows for regular, disciplined monthly savings. It firmly demands the consumer deposit a predetermined, fixed sum of money at regular monthly intervals for a specified duration. When the set period expires and maturity is achieved, the bank returns the total accrued principal to the depositor, along with the compounded interest generated during that timeframe.
